Access Control Vulnerability in Odoo Community and Enterprise Products
CVE-2018-14859
8.1HIGH
What is CVE-2018-14859?
An access control vulnerability exists in the password reset functionality of Odoo Community and Enterprise products, enabling authenticated users to exploit a secure token mechanism. This flaw allows an attacker to reset passwords of other users if they are the first to use the generated secure token. Proper security measures and updated software versions are essential to mitigate this risk.
